Chris Round

Chris Round is an award-winning landscape photographer based in Sydney, Australia. From documenting landscapes featuring direct human interventions to exploring ideas of place, Chris’s work primarily investigates our ever-changing relationship with the 21st-century environment.

He studied at Canterbury College of Art and the School of Communication Arts in the UK and Sydney College of Art. Chris also has a successful advertising career, winning many international accolades, including a coveted Grand Prix at Cannes. Chris has been recognised locally and internationally, winning the Lucie Foundation IPA Film Photographer of the Year and the Australia National Award, among others. His work is in public and private collections worldwide, including the Parliament NSW Collection and Macquarie Group Collection.
